From 5afeedde1f4a2eb16607de41d4169a2d58232c0b Mon Sep 17 00:00:00 2001 From: Alejandra Garcia Rojas M Date: Tue, 6 Jan 2015 16:04:28 +0100 Subject: [PATCH] add creation of configuration directories --- .../debian/geoknow-generator-ui.cron.d.ex | 4 ---- .../debian/geoknow-generator-ui.default.ex | 10 ---------- .../debian/geoknow-generator-ui.doc-base.EX | 20 ------------------- .../debian/geoknow-generator-ui.postinst | 9 +++++++++ deb-package/debian/rules | 2 +- 5 files changed, 10 insertions(+), 35 deletions(-) delete mode 100644 deb-package/debian/geoknow-generator-ui.cron.d.ex delete mode 100644 deb-package/debian/geoknow-generator-ui.default.ex delete mode 100644 deb-package/debian/geoknow-generator-ui.doc-base.EX create mode 100644 deb-package/debian/geoknow-generator-ui.postinst diff --git a/deb-package/debian/geoknow-generator-ui.cron.d.ex b/deb-package/debian/geoknow-generator-ui.cron.d.ex deleted file mode 100644 index 807ff27..0000000 --- a/deb-package/debian/geoknow-generator-ui.cron.d.ex +++ /dev/null @@ -1,4 +0,0 @@ -# -# Regular cron jobs for the geoknow-generator-ui package -# -0 4 * * * root [ -x /usr/bin/geoknow-generator-ui_maintenance ] && /usr/bin/geoknow-generator-ui_maintenance diff --git a/deb-package/debian/geoknow-generator-ui.default.ex b/deb-package/debian/geoknow-generator-ui.default.ex deleted file mode 100644 index 462c71d..0000000 --- a/deb-package/debian/geoknow-generator-ui.default.ex +++ /dev/null @@ -1,10 +0,0 @@ -# Defaults for geoknow-generator-ui initscript -# sourced by /etc/init.d/geoknow-generator-ui -# installed at /etc/default/geoknow-generator-ui by the maintainer scripts - -# -# This is a POSIX shell fragment -# - -# Additional options that are passed to the Daemon. -DAEMON_OPTS="" diff --git a/deb-package/debian/geoknow-generator-ui.doc-base.EX b/deb-package/debian/geoknow-generator-ui.doc-base.EX deleted file mode 100644 index 5c53f6e..0000000 --- a/deb-package/debian/geoknow-generator-ui.doc-base.EX +++ /dev/null @@ -1,20 +0,0 @@ -Document: geoknow-generator-ui -Title: Debian geoknow-generator-ui Manual -Author: -Abstract: This manual describes what geoknow-generator-ui is - and how it can be used to - manage online manuals on Debian systems. -Section: unknown - -Format: debiandoc-sgml -Files: /usr/share/doc/geoknow-generator-ui/geoknow-generator-ui.sgml.gz - -Format: postscript -Files: /usr/share/doc/geoknow-generator-ui/geoknow-generator-ui.ps.gz - -Format: text -Files: /usr/share/doc/geoknow-generator-ui/geoknow-generator-ui.text.gz - -Format: HTML -Index: /usr/share/doc/geoknow-generator-ui/html/index.html -Files: /usr/share/doc/geoknow-generator-ui/html/*.html diff --git a/deb-package/debian/geoknow-generator-ui.postinst b/deb-package/debian/geoknow-generator-ui.postinst new file mode 100644 index 0000000..7b13b65 --- /dev/null +++ b/deb-package/debian/geoknow-generator-ui.postinst @@ -0,0 +1,9 @@ +#!/bin/sh + +#DEBHELPER# + +set -e + +USER="tomcat7" + +chown -R ${USER}:${USER} /etc/generator diff --git a/deb-package/debian/rules b/deb-package/debian/rules index 79fd842..560c1d7 100755 --- a/deb-package/debian/rules +++ b/deb-package/debian/rules @@ -2,7 +2,7 @@ # -*- makefile -*- # Uncomment this to turn on verbose mode. -#export DH_VERBOSE=1 +# export DH_VERBOSE=1 %: dh $@